AntiMicroX:免费开源的手柄映射工具,让所有PC游戏都支持游戏控制器
【免费下载链接】antimicroxGraph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support.项目地址: https://gitcode.com/GitHub_Trending/an/antimicrox
你是否遇到过这样的困境?发现了一款心仪已久的PC游戏,却发现它根本不支持你的游戏手柄;或者长时间使用键盘鼠标玩游戏后,手腕和手指开始酸痛。别担心,现在有了AntiMicroX这款完全免费开源的图形化手柄映射工具,你可以将任何游戏手柄的按键映射到键盘和鼠标操作,让所有PC游戏都能用手柄畅玩!
无论你是Linux还是Windows用户,这款强大的按键映射软件都能让你的游戏体验焕然一新。想象一下,用舒适的手柄操作那些原本只支持键盘的老游戏,或者为有特殊需求的玩家提供更多操作选择——这就是AntiMicroX带给你的核心价值。
为什么你需要一款专业的手柄映射工具?
在深入探索AntiMicroX之前,让我们先理解为什么游戏控制器配置如此重要。现代PC游戏虽然大多支持手柄,但仍有大量经典游戏、独立游戏和模拟器游戏只提供键盘操作。更不用说,有些玩家因为身体原因需要使用特定的控制方式。
三大核心痛点让你无法忽视:
- 操作舒适度:长时间使用键盘鼠标容易导致手腕疲劳和重复性劳损
- 游戏兼容性:许多经典游戏和独立游戏缺乏原生手柄支持
- 个性化需求:不同玩家有不同的操作习惯和特殊需求
AntiMicroX的独特优势:为什么它是你的最佳选择?
与其他手柄映射工具相比,AntiMicroX在多个维度上都表现出色:
| 对比维度 | AntiMicroX | 其他商业工具 |
|---|---|---|
| 价格策略 | 完全免费开源 | 通常需要付费购买 |
| 平台支持 | Linux + Windows双平台 | 通常只支持单一平台 |
| 功能完整性 | 从基础映射到高级宏全覆盖 | 功能有限,高级功能需额外付费 |
| 社区生态 | 活跃的开源社区持续维护 | 依赖厂商更新,响应慢 |
| 自定义程度 | 高度可定制,代码完全透明 | 预设配置为主,修改困难 |
🎯 完全开源免费:没有任何隐藏费用,代码完全透明,你可以自由查看、修改甚至贡献代码🔄 跨平台兼容:完美支持Linux和Windows系统,无论你使用什么操作系统都能获得一致体验⚡ 功能全面强大:从最简单的按键映射到复杂的宏命令序列,满足从新手到专家的所有需求👥 社区驱动发展:遇到问题可以快速获得社区帮助,功能更新紧跟用户需求
核心功能详解:AntiMicroX如何实现完美映射
直观的图形化映射界面
AntiMicroX的主界面设计直观易用,左侧显示手柄物理布局,右侧是详细的按键绑定设置。这种设计让你一眼就能看到所有映射关系,无需在复杂的菜单中寻找。
主界面清晰展示了Logitech Dual Action手柄的所有按键映射配置,你可以看到每个按钮对应的键盘按键,如A键映射为空格键,B键映射为回车键等。
界面特点:
- 实时可视化反馈:点击手柄上的按钮,界面会高亮显示
- 多配置集管理:为不同游戏创建独立的配置文件
- 一键切换:在不同游戏配置之间快速切换
专业的摇杆校准系统
精准的控制是游戏体验的关键,特别是对于需要精细操作的游戏。AntiMicroX提供了专业的摇杆校准功能,确保你的操作准确无误。
校准界面指导用户将摇杆移动到各个极限位置,系统自动记录校准数据,确保操作无偏移。你可以看到轴检测的实时数值反馈。
校准过程三步走:
- 选择校准对象:从下拉菜单中选择需要校准的摇杆
- 中心位置校准:按照提示将摇杆置于中心位置
- 极限位置校准:将摇杆移动到各个方向极限位置
强大的高级功能配置
当基础映射无法满足你的需求时,AntiMicroX的高级功能就派上用场了。无论是复杂的宏命令还是精确的时间控制,这里都能实现。
高级设置界面支持复杂的按键绑定逻辑,包括插入、合并、拆分绑定,以及精确的时间延迟设置。你可以创建包含多个步骤的宏命令序列。
高级功能亮点:
- 复杂宏命令:将多个按键操作组合成一个动作
- 精确时间控制:设置按键之间的毫秒级延迟
- 循环执行:让某些操作自动重复执行
- 条件触发:根据特定条件执行不同的操作序列
SDL2底层硬件映射
对于开发者或高级用户,AntiMicroX还提供了SDL2底层映射功能,确保最佳的硬件兼容性和性能表现。
控制器映射界面显示硬件控制器与SDL2游戏控制器API的直接绑定关系,支持死区调整和轴事件监测。你可以看到详细的SDL映射字符串。
SDL映射优势:
- 硬件级兼容:直接与手柄硬件通信,延迟最低
- 跨平台一致性:SDL2提供统一的API接口
- 死区调整:避免摇杆微小移动导致的误操作
- 标准化输出:确保游戏能够正确识别手柄输入
实战指南:5分钟完成你的第一个手柄配置
第一步:安装AntiMicroX
根据你的操作系统选择合适的安装方式:
Linux用户(Ubuntu/Debian):
sudo apt update sudo apt install antimicroxWindows用户:
- 访问项目页面下载最新安装包
- 运行安装程序,按照向导完成安装
通用安装(Flatpak):
flatpak install flathub io.github.antimicrox.antimicrox第二步:连接并识别手柄
- 通过USB或蓝牙连接你的游戏手柄
- 打开AntiMicroX,程序会自动检测到连接的设备
- 确认手柄在设备列表中显示正常
第三步:基础按键映射
- 在主界面点击手柄上的任意按钮
- 按下你想要对应的键盘按键
- 重复这个过程,为所有需要的按钮设置映射
小贴士:从最常用的按钮开始,如A/B/X/Y键和方向键,这些通常是游戏中最频繁使用的控制。
第四步:保存和应用配置
- 点击"保存"按钮,为配置命名
- 选择保存位置(建议使用默认位置)
- 启动游戏,享受手柄操作带来的舒适体验
进阶技巧:释放手柄的全部潜力
配置文件管理与同步
定期备份你的配置文件非常重要。AntiMicroX的配置文件存储在以下位置:
- Linux:
~/.config/antimicrox/ - Windows:
%APPDATA%/antimicrox/
管理建议:
- 云端同步:将配置文件同步到云端服务(如Google Drive、Dropbox)
- 版本控制:使用Git管理配置文件的不同版本
- 分享配置:将优秀的配置分享给其他玩家
自动配置文件切换
AntiMicroX支持基于活动窗口的自动配置文件切换功能。这意味着当你在不同游戏之间切换时,程序会自动加载对应的配置文件。
配置方法:
- 为每个游戏创建独立的配置文件
- 进入"设置" -> "自动配置文件"
- 添加游戏窗口规则(可以使用窗口标题或进程名)
- 保存设置,享受无缝切换体验
性能优化建议
如果你的映射有延迟或响应不灵敏,可以尝试以下优化:
选择正确的后端:
- Linux:优先使用uinput后端
- Windows:优先使用WinSendInput后端
调整死区设置:
- 适当增加死区值可以减少误操作
- 但不要设置过大,否则会影响灵敏度
关闭不必要的宏:
- 复杂的宏命令会增加处理时间
- 只保留必要的宏功能
不同游戏类型的优化配置方案
动作游戏配置方案
对于需要快速反应的动作游戏,响应速度是关键:
- 主要攻击键:映射到手柄上最顺手的按钮(A、B、X、Y键)
- 组合技能:设置在肩键(L1/R1)和扳机键(L2/R2)上
- 防御闪避:使用方向键或右摇杆
- 特殊技能:通过宏命令实现一键连招
角色扮演游戏配置方案
RPG游戏通常需要频繁使用菜单和物品栏:
- 菜单导航:方向键映射为菜单导航
- 快速物品:肩键设置为快速使用物品
- 鼠标控制:右摇杆映射为鼠标移动
- 对话确认:A键映射为回车或空格键
射击游戏配置方案
射击游戏需要精确的瞄准和快速反应:
- 视角控制:右摇杆映射为鼠标移动,调整合适的灵敏度
- 射击按键:扳机键映射为鼠标左键
- 换弹动作:通过组合键或宏命令实现
- 特殊动作:设置快捷宏命令,如蹲下-瞄准-射击序列
常见问题解答:快速解决使用障碍
问题1:手柄连接但AntiMicroX无响应
解决方案:
- 检查USB接口是否松动,尝试重新插拔手柄
- 点击界面上的"刷新"按钮重新扫描设备
- 使用系统自带的手柄测试工具确认手柄正常工作
- 查看系统日志获取详细错误信息
问题2:配置设置意外丢失
预防措施:
- 定期使用"导出"功能备份配置文件
- 确保程序有正确的文件写入权限
- 避免在程序运行时直接关闭计算机
- 使用版本控制工具管理配置文件历史
问题3:映射延迟过高
优化建议:
- 在设置中选择合适的后端(Linux选uinput,Windows选WinSendInput)
- 合理设置死区范围,避免过度校准
- 关闭不必要的后台程序,释放系统资源
- 避免为每个按键都设置复杂的宏命令
问题4:游戏不识别映射
排查步骤:
- 确认AntiMicroX在游戏启动前已运行
- 检查游戏是否以管理员权限运行(Windows)
- 尝试不同的映射后端设置
- 查看游戏的控制设置选项,确保没有冲突
开始你的手柄游戏新时代!
通过本指南,你已经掌握了AntiMicroX从安装配置到高级使用的完整知识。这款强大的免费手柄映射方案不仅能解决你的游戏兼容性问题,还能大幅提升游戏体验的舒适度。
现在就是开始的最佳时机!按照以下行动步骤,立即开始你的手柄游戏之旅:
- 立即下载:根据你的操作系统选择合适的版本
- 连接设备:确保手柄被系统正确识别
- 基础配置:为最常玩的游戏创建基本映射
- 逐步优化:根据实际体验调整设置
- 分享经验:将你的成功配置分享给其他玩家
记住,好的工具需要适当的配置才能发挥最大价值。花一点时间优化你的手柄映射,就能在游戏中获得全新的操作乐趣和更舒适的游戏体验!
💡 专业建议:如果你是开发者或技术爱好者,还可以参与AntiMicroX的开源贡献。项目代码完全开放,你可以提交功能建议、修复bug或改进文档,帮助这个优秀的项目变得更好,让更多玩家受益!
无论你是想重温经典游戏的老玩家,还是寻求更舒适操作方式的新玩家,AntiMicroX都是你不可或缺的游戏控制器配置工具。立即开始使用,发现手柄游戏的无限可能!
【免费下载链接】antimicroxGraph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support.项目地址: https://gitcode.com/GitHub_Trending/an/antimicrox
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考